George spoke with Eric Steuer about one of his favorite docs, EXIT THROUGH THE GIFT SHOP (2010). The only film credited to Banksy, Exit Through The Gift Shop tells the story of Thierry Guetta, a self-taught street artist/documentarian who ends up becoming the subject of the film.

We sat down with comedian Krista Fatka to discuss Vikram Gandhi’s 2012 documentary KUMARE. Gandhi, a lapsed Hindu, conducts an experiment posing as a guru named Kumare. Kumare/Gandhi attracts a number of followers in Arizona and the question is when and how he’ll reveal the truth behind Kumare.

A podcast about a documentary about radio? Only on this show! George spoke with the director of Sex and Broadcasting, Tim K Smith in Los Angeles. Sex and Broadcasting is a 2014 documentary about New Jersey’s longstanding freeform radio station WFMU, and its struggles to stay afloat.
